If you’re considering a move, investment, or business opportunity in ZIP 30328, located in the heart of Sandy Springs, Georgia, this demographic and housing snapshot offers a clear picture of the area in 2023. With a robust population, strong income levels, and a diverse community, this ZIP code presents unique opportunities for homebuyers, real estate investors, small-business owners, and analysts. Let’s break down the key metrics to help you make informed decisions about living, working, or investing here.
ZIP 30328 is home to 38,821 residents, making it a sizable and vibrant community. This population is spread across 18,607 households, reflecting a mix of family units, singles, and professionals. The area also has 19,878 total housing units, indicating a slight surplus of available homes compared to occupied households. This balance suggests potential opportunities for buyers or renters looking to settle in a well-established area with room for growth.
One of the standout features of ZIP 30328 is its strong economic profile. The median household income stands at $113,736, well above the national average, signaling a prosperous community with significant purchasing power. For homebuyers and investors, the median house value of $551,600 reflects a premium real estate market, likely driven by the area’s desirability and proximity to Atlanta’s economic hubs. Renters, meanwhile, face a median rent of $1,943 per month, which aligns with the higher cost of living and suggests a competitive rental market for property owners.
The demographic makeup of ZIP 30328 is notably diverse, fostering a multicultural environment that appeals to a wide range of residents and businesses. The racial composition includes 58.55% White, 17.73% Black, 12.29% Asian, and 6.61% Hispanic residents. This diversity not only enriches the community’s cultural fabric but also offers businesses and investors a broad customer base with varied needs and preferences.
For homebuyers, ZIP 30328 offers a premium market with median home values at $551,600. The area’s high median income suggests neighbors with financial stability, and the slight surplus of housing units could mean less competition for the right property. However, be prepared for a higher cost of entry, whether buying or renting at a median of $1,943 per month.
For investors and real estate agents, the numbers point to a lucrative opportunity. The strong household income and elevated property values indicate potential for solid returns on investment, especially in a market with diverse demographics. The rental market also appears robust, with high demand reflected in the median rent figures.
For small-business owners, the diverse population of 38,821 and high median income of $113,736 suggest a customer base with disposable income and varied needs. Whether you’re opening a retail store, restaurant, or service-based business, the multicultural makeup offers a chance to cater to a wide audience.
For analysts, these metrics provide a foundation for deeper research into market trends, housing demand, and economic forecasts. The balance of housing units to households and the income-to-cost ratio are key indicators to watch for future growth patterns in ZIP 30328.
